About This Home
This beautiful home is nestled on a quiet cul-de-sac in the heart of Temecula, just minutes from wine country. A spacious living room that features vaulted ceilings, a family room with a fireplace, a kitchen with granite countertops, and an island. There is a downstairs bedroom and a full bathroom. Upstairs has 3 more great bedrooms, including a huge master with a walk-in closet, separate shower/tub, and a balcony that overlooks a really nice backyard with a lawn, trees and a covered patio for relaxation. The house comes with a 2-car garage.
41557 Corte Pergamino is a house located in Riverside County and the 92592 ZIP Code. This area is served by the Temecula Valley Unified attendance zone.

Temecula, set in Southern California's wine country, combines small-town atmosphere with modern living amenities. The historic Old Town district features preserved buildings, local shops, and restaurants, plus a weekly farmers' market every Saturday. Current rental rates range from $2,147 for one-bedroom units to $3,235 for three-bedroom homes, with prices showing slight decreases over the past year. The city features 41 parks and 22 miles of trails, while the acclaimed Temecula Valley Wine Country, home to nearly 50 wineries, lies just east of the city limits.
Residents enjoy both suburban comfort and outdoor recreation, including golf courses and the annual Balloon & Wine Festival at Lake Skinner. The Redhawk area offers planned community amenities, while Old Town provides a mix of historic and contemporary housing options. Students attend schools in the Temecula Valley Unified School District, and Mount San Jacinto College serves the area's higher education needs.
